1. 08 Nov, 2014 7 commits
  2. 07 Nov, 2014 9 commits
    • Juri Linkov's avatar
      * lisp/replace.el: History for query replace pairs. · 2b513c3b
      Juri Linkov authored
      (query-replace-defaults): Promote to a list of cons cell.  Doc fix.
      (query-replace-from-to-separator): New variable.
      (query-replace-read-from): Let-bind query-replace-from-to-history
      to a list of FROM-TO strings created from query-replace-defaults
      and separated by query-replace-from-to-separator.  Use it as
      the history while reading from the minibuffer.  Split the returned
      string by the separator to get FROM and TO parts, and add them
      to the history variables.
      (query-replace-read-to): Add FROM-TO pairs to query-replace-defaults.
      (query-replace-regexp-eval): Let-bind query-replace-defaults to nil.
      * lisp/isearch.el (isearch-text-char-description): Keep characters
      intact and put formatted strings with the `display' property.
    • Stefan Monnier's avatar
      * src/keyboard.c: Call gui-set-selection instead of x-set-selection. · 3946aeb9
      Stefan Monnier authored
      * src/xdisp.c (window-scroll-functions): Improve docstring.
    • Paul Eggert's avatar
      Uniquify the 'size' symbol. · 0e44a2d2
      Paul Eggert authored
      * frame.c (Qsize):
      * w32notify.c (Qsize): Remove.
      * lisp.h (Qsize): New decl.
      * lread.c (Qsize): Now extern.
      * w32notify.c (syms_of_w32notify): No need to defsym.
    • Katsumi Yamaoka's avatar
    • Martin Rudalics's avatar
      Improve inhibiting of implied frame resizes. · 1c50b3ad
      Martin Rudalics authored
      * frames.texi (Size and Position): Rewrite description of
      * cus-start.el (frame-resize-pixelwise): Fix group.
      (frame-inhibit-implied-resize): Add entry.
      * dispnew.c (change_frame_size_1): Fix call of
      * frame.c (Qsize, Qframe_position, Qframe_outer_size)
      (Qframe_inner_size, Qexternal_border_size, Qtitle_height)
      (Qmenu_bar_external, Qmenu_bar_size, Qtool_bar_external)
      (Qtool_bar_size): New constants.
      (frame_inhibit_resize, adjust_frame_size): New argument to
      handle case where frame_inhibit_implied_resize is a list.
      (Fmake_terminal_frame, Fset_frame_height, Fset_frame_width)
      (Fset_frame_size, x_set_left_fringe, x_set_right_fringe)
      (x_set_right_divider_width, x_set_bottom_divider_width)
      (x_set_vertical_scroll_bars, x_set_horizontal_scroll_bars)
      (x_set_scroll_bar_width, x_set_scroll_bar_height): Update
      (frame-inhibit-implied-resize): Rewrite doc-string.
      * frame.h (frame_inhibit_resize, adjust_frame_size): Fix
      external declarations.
      (Qframe_position, Qframe_outer_size)
      (Qframe_inner_size, Qexternal_border_size, Qtitle_height)
      (Qmenu_bar_external, Qmenu_bar_size, Qtool_bar_external)
      (Qtool_bar_size): Extern them.
      (xg_height_or_width_changed): Remove.
      (xg_frame_set_char_size): Adjust adjust_frame_size calls.
      (menubar_map_cb, xg_update_frame_menubar, free_frame_menubar)
      (tb_size_cb, update_frame_tool_bar, free_frame_tool_bar)
      (xg_change_toolbar_position): Call adjust_frame_size directly.
      * nsfns.m (x_set_internal_border_width, Fx_create_frame): Fix
      calls of adjust_frame_size.
      * w32fns.c (x_set_internal_border_width, x_set_menu_bar_lines)
      (Fx_create_frame, x_create_tip_frame): Adjust adjust_frame_size
      (x_set_tool_bar_lines, x_change_tool_bar_height): Make sure that
      frame can get resized when tool-bar-lines parameter changes from
      or to zero.
      (Fw32_frame_menu_bar_size): Return fourth value.
      (Fw32_frame_rect): Block input around system calls
      (Fx_frame_geometry): New function.
      * w32menu.c (set_frame_menubar): Adjust adjust_frame_size call.
      * w32term.c (x_new_font): Adjust adjust_frame_size call.
      * widget.c (EmacsFrameSetCharSize): Adjust frame_inhibit_resize
      * window.c (Fset_window_configuration): Adjust adjust_frame_size
      * xfns.c (x_set_menu_bar_lines, x_set_internal_border_width)
      (Fx_create_frame): Adjust adjust_frame_size calls.
      (x_set_tool_bar_lines, x_change_tool_bar_height): Make sure that
      frame can get resized when tool-bar-lines parameter changes from
      or to zero.
      (Fx_frame_geometry): New function.
      * xmenu.c (update_frame_menubar): On Lucid call
      adjust_frame_size with one pixel less height to avoid that
      repeatedly adding/removing the menu bar grows the frame.
      (free_frame_menubar): On Motif arrange to optionally preserve
      the old frame height when removing the menu bar.
      * xterm.c (x_new_font): Adjust adjust_frame_size call.
    • Tassilo Horn's avatar
      doc/misc/{gnus.texi,gnus-faq.texi}: Add link to EWW manual · a067ef9a
      Tassilo Horn authored
      * gnus.texi (HTML): Update section so that it mentions shr and w3m.
      Also link the full EWW manual that explains more on shr, too.
      * gnus-faq.texi (FAQ 4 - Reading messages, FAQ 4-16): Add Q&A on how to
      increase contrast when displaying HTML mail with shr.
    • Tassilo Horn's avatar
      Document how to increase contrast in EWW/shr · 361ffe13
      Tassilo Horn authored
      * doc/misc/eww.texi (Advanced): Document increasing contrast with
      shr-color-visible-distance-min and
    • Daiki Ueno's avatar
      epg: Utilize --pinentry-mode added in GnuPG 2.1 · b912aed9
      Daiki Ueno authored
      * epa.el (epa-pinentry-mode): New user option.
      (epa-sign-file, epa-encrypt-file, epa-decrypt-region)
      (epa-sign-region, epa-encrypt-region): Respect epa-pinentry-mode.
      * epa-file.el (epa-file-insert-file-contents)
      (epa-file-write-region): Respect epa-pinentry-mode.
    • Daiki Ueno's avatar
      epg: Adjust to GnuPG 2.1 key listing change · 135a9f4b
      Daiki Ueno authored
      * epg.el (epg--list-keys-1): Ignore fields after the 15th field
      (bug#18979).  Reported by Hideki Saito.
  3. 06 Nov, 2014 6 commits
  4. 05 Nov, 2014 13 commits
  5. 04 Nov, 2014 5 commits